Why buy a used BMW 7 Series?

If you're in the market for a car that's large, comfortable and refined, then a used BMW 7 Series is a great choice. This premium saloon comes with a large amount of kit and is designed to impress even the most discerning passenger. With its extensive range of powertrain options, including a long-range PHEV, there's a 7 Series for any need.

Used BMW 7 Series buying guide

Engines and transmissions

BMW has offered petrol, hybrid and diesel configurations, with a manual or an automatic gearbox and rear- or four-wheel drive. Currently, the new 7 Series is only available as a petrol-hybrid model.

Petrol
  • 750e xDrive plug-in hybrid creates a combined 482bhp and provides up to 55 miles of travel on electric-only
  • 760e xDrive plug-in hybrid increases the output to 563bhp with a similar electric driving range of 52 miles
  • Older 740i uses a 3.0-litre engine to produce 321bhp and 41mpg, while the 750i uses a 4.4-litre V8 engine to generate 443bhp and 35mpg
  • This 750i was later upgraded to 522bhp, but the fuel economy was reduced to 27.2mpg
  • Range-topping M760Li has a 6.6-litre V12 engine that rivals supercars with power at 601bhp, and a fuel economy of 22mpg
Diesel
  • 725d has a 2.0-litre engine to output 227bhp and features efficiency of up to 46.3mpg
  • 730d increases the output to 261bhp with a 3.0-litre engine, and the fuel economy could rise to 51.4mpg, depending on the model variant

740d boosts the rating to 315bhp, making it one of the more powerful diesels offered, with a fuel economy of up to 47.1mpg

Practicality

With ample space for all passengers, the BMW 7 Series is a practical executive saloon designed to keep everyone comfortable during the drive.

Interior space
  • Driver can easily get comfortable with a soft headrest and an adjustable backrest
  • Rear seating space is perfect for taller adults
  • Large glass roof allows for a brighter, more inviting cabin space
Boot space
  • 525-litre boot is big and square with a low-loading lip
  • PHEV boot remains the same, which isn't the case with rivals such as the Audi A8 and Mercedes-Benz S580e
  • Under-floor storage space allows for smaller items to be carried

Safety

  • Euro NCAP hasn't safety tested the 7 Series
  • Standard kit includes the BMW Active Protection System, which monitors driver distraction and takes preventative measures if an accident is imminent

Technology

  • 12.3-inch driver display and 14.9-inch infotainment screen appear to be one under the curved glass, even though they are separate
  • Wireless Apple CarPlay and Android Auto offer quick connections
  • Available Bowers & Wilkins stereo can be fitted with equipment to vibrate and pulse the rear seat for an immersive experience
  • An 8K 31-inch theatre screen with built-in internet connection that flips down from the roof can also be included

Different generations of used BMW 7 Series

The 7 Series first hit the roads back in 1977 with the E23. It was met with such success that a second generation (E32) was needed by 1986, and there was also the option of a long-wheelbase model. Since then, there have been a total of seven generations, with BMW adding more technology, refinement and comfort with each update.

Seventh Generation (2022 to Present)

Over four decades since its introduction, BMW launched a seventh-generation 7 Series with its first-ever electric configuration (the i7). The vehicle had a new design with a wide, tall grille and LED daytime running lights were installed higher up. New air intakes were also added along with a new lower grille for added cooling.

Several updates were made inside the cabin, including a new 12.3-inch driver display and a 14.9-inch infotainment touchscreen - both were featured under glass, making them look like they were part of one display. A standard Panoramic Sky Lounge LED roof contained a fixed, single glass surface encased within a steel frame.

Sixth Generation (2015 to 2023)

BMW updated the 7 Series platform with a carbon-fibre reinforced polymer design. Nearly every design element was brand new with this generation, including the exhaust, paint colours, wheel designs and taillights. Even the kidney grille was larger.

In 2019, BMW offered an update with new headlights, and a new grille and bonnet. New vents were added to pull air from the wheel area, thereby reducing the aerodynamic lift of the vehicle. A full-width light strip was also installed in the rear.

Fifth Generation (2008 to 2015)

BMW hoped to return to a more traditional style with the fifth-generation 7 Series. The large headlights were placed for a better connection with the bumper, while the long, straight lines were added to the car's design to make it look longer.

By 2012, the 7 Series was ready for a facelift, which included updates for new emissions standards. Most of the design remained, except for some new LED headlights and a redesigned bumper. There were also fewer slats added to the grille.

Used BMW 7 Series FAQ's

Is the BMW 7 Series a good car?

With a refined look, advanced technology and decent pace, the BMW 7 Series ticks a lot of boxes. And with its choice of engines, you can choose a trim that suits your lifestyle and desired running costs. Cheaper than its rivals by Mercedes and Audi, it's also equipped with ample safety features. And although BMW isn't one of the top-rated car manufacturers for reliability, reported problems with the 7 Series are few. These include issues with the diesel engines, gearbox and interior trims.

Which BMW 7 Series is the best?

When it comes to speed, the M760Li xDrive is top of the range with its 6.6-litre twin-turbo V12 engine. Producing 602bhp, it reaches 62mph in just 3.7 seconds. However, if you're looking to save on fuel, the 740 and 750 trims handle brilliantly for their size with their carbon fibre giving them a lighter feel.

Is the BMW 7 Series expensive to maintain?

If you're looking to keep running costs down, you'll want to stay away from its petrol engines. The plug-in hybrid 745e is the most economical BMW 7 Series trim, boasting a fuel economy of 141mpg and low CO2 emissions of 46g/km. Thanks to its fixed emissions, it also gives you free access to certain cities with low emission zones. You'll also need to keep in mind the BMW 7 Series' high insurance groups as a result of its powerful performance and complex engineering - even the 740i and 730d sit in insurance groups 48 and 49. Annual road tax ranges from £165 to £580, while repairs can be expensive.

Where is the BMW 7 Series manufactured?

Since its launch in 1977, the BMW 7 Series has been manufactured at the BMW Group Plant in Dingolfing, Germany.
